construct a temperature sensor for measuring the ambient outside temperature in Borrego Springs (-30oC  T 40oC). You decide to base operation of the temperature sensor on the change in resistance associated with a bar-shaped piece of n-type Si. A relatively small cross section would allow a more rapid response to temperature change. To be specific, use a bar of 1 cm long with an area of 1 mm x 1 mm.

(a) Restricting yourself to nondegenerate dopings and also requiring the resistance to be readily measured with a hand-held multimeter (say 1  R 1000), what is the range of doping? Pick a doping concentration in the mid range.

(b)check the doping concentration you picked can work within the specified temperature range. (c) Derive an expression for the sensitivity (dR/dT in ?/ oC) of your sensor. (d) Is it preferable to use low or high dopings?
